1. Google Search Console
Google Search Console is a free service provided by Google that helps website owners monitor and optimize their site’s performance in Google Search results. It offers insights into how Google views a website and provides actionable data to improve visibility.
Purpose | Monitor website performance, identify indexing issues, submit sitemaps, analyze search traffic, and receive alerts for technical problems affecting rankings. |
---|---|
Key Features | Tracks impressions, clicks, and keyword positions; submits sitemaps; identifies crawl errors; provides mobile usability reports. |
Use Case | Ideal for website owners and SEO professionals to ensure a site is indexed correctly and to optimize for Google Search. |
By leveraging Google Search Console, users can ensure their website is technically sound and aligned with Google’s search algorithms, making it a foundational tool for SEO.
2. Google Analytics
Google Analytics is a powerful, free tool that tracks and analyzes website traffic and user behavior. Its latest version, Google Analytics 4, uses machine learning to provide predictive insights, helping users understand audience interactions.
Purpose | Analyze website traffic, user behavior, and conversion metrics to inform SEO strategies and content optimization. |
---|---|
Key Features | Tracks traffic sources, page views, bounce rates, and conversions; integrates with Google Search Console for comprehensive data. |
Use Case | Useful for marketers and site owners to measure the impact of SEO efforts and refine content based on user engagement. |
This tool helps users understand which pages attract the most visitors and how users interact with the site, enabling data-driven SEO decisions.
3. Google Keyword Planner
Google Keyword Planner, part of Google Ads, is a free tool designed for keyword research, offering insights into search volume, competition, and keyword suggestions for both organic and paid campaigns.
Purpose | Identify relevant keywords, assess search volume, and discover new keyword ideas to optimize content for search engines. |
---|---|
Key Features | Provides monthly search volume, competition level, and suggested keywords; supports industry and location-specific searches. |
Use Case | Best for beginners and marketers planning content or PPC campaigns to target high-value, low-competition keywords. |
Google Keyword Planner is a go-to tool for building a keyword strategy that aligns with user search intent.
4. Yoast SEO (Free Version)
Yoast SEO is a popular WordPress plugin with a robust free version that assists users in optimizing on-page SEO elements and improving content readability.
Purpose | Optimize on-page SEO elements like meta tags, titles, and content readability to improve search engine rankings. |
---|---|
Key Features | Generates XML sitemaps, provides real-time content analysis, and offers suggestions for meta descriptions and titles. |
Use Case | Perfect for WordPress users seeking to enhance on-page SEO without advanced technical knowledge. |
Yoast SEO’s free version is particularly valuable for beginners, offering clear guidance to optimize content effectively.
5. Ahrefs Webmaster Tools (AWT)
Ahrefs Webmaster Tools is a free suite that provides website owners with insights into SEO performance, including backlink analysis and content gap identification.
Purpose | Conduct site audits, analyze backlinks, and identify keyword opportunities to improve rankings and content strategy. |
---|---|
Key Features | Crawls up to 5,000 URLs, lists competitor keywords, and identifies unlinked brand mentions for link-building opportunities. |
Use Case | Ideal for small businesses and bloggers looking to audit their site and find low-competition keywords. |
AWT’s free tier is a generous offering for those needing basic SEO audits and competitor analysis without a paid subscription.

7. Answer The Public
Answer The Public is a free tool that generates long-tail keyword ideas and questions based on a seed keyword, helping users create content that matches search intent.
Purpose | Discover question-based and long-tail keywords to create content that addresses user queries and improves rankings. |
---|---|
Key Features | Provides visualizations of search queries, including questions, prepositions, and comparisons related to a keyword. |
Use Case | Great for content creators and bloggers aiming to target niche, question-based search terms. |
This tool is particularly useful for crafting blog posts or FAQs that align with what users are searching for.

9. Google Trends
Google Trends is a free tool that analyzes the popularity of search terms over time, helping users identify seasonal trends and compare keyword popularity.
Purpose | Identify trending keywords and seasonal variations to inform content planning and SEO strategies. |
---|---|
Key Features | Shows search volume trends, compares multiple keywords, and provides regional interest data. |
Use Case | Useful for marketers and content creators planning timely content around trending topics or seasonal keywords. |
Google Trends helps users stay ahead of search trends and optimize content for maximum relevance.
10. MozBar
MozBar is a free browser extension that provides instant SEO metrics while browsing websites, including domain authority, page authority, and on-page elements.
Purpose | Analyze on-page SEO metrics and competitor websites to identify opportunities for optimization and link building. |
---|---|
Key Features | Displays domain and page authority, keyword density, and link data; highlights nofollow links and meta tags. |
Use Case | Best for SEO professionals and marketers conducting quick competitor analysis or on-page checks. |
MozBar is a convenient tool for real-time SEO insights without needing to navigate complex dashboards.

13. Bing Webmaster Tools
Bing Webmaster Tools is a free service that helps website owners monitor and optimize their site’s performance on Bing’s search engine.
Purpose | Track site performance, identify technical issues, and optimize for Bing’s search engine to improve rankings. |
---|---|
Key Features | Provides backlink tracking, keyword research, site audits, and 16-month performance history; integrates with Microsoft Clarity. |
Use Case | Useful for businesses targeting Bing users or seeking additional SEO insights beyond Google. |
Bing Webmaster Tools complements Google Search Console for a broader SEO strategy.
14. Seed Keywords
Seed Keywords is a free tool that leverages crowdsourcing to uncover unique keyword ideas by prompting users to suggest search terms based on hypothetical scenarios.
Purpose | Discover unique, user-driven keyword ideas to inform content creation and align with real-world search behavior. |
---|---|
Key Features | Creates unique URLs for collecting keyword suggestions; focuses on user intent rather than automated metrics. |
Use Case | Best for marketers and content creators seeking creative keyword ideas for niche audiences. |
Seed Keywords offers a fresh approach to keyword research by tapping into human insights.

16. Merkle’s Schema Generator
Merkle’s Schema Generator is a free tool that creates structured data markup in JSON-LD format to help search engines understand website content better.
Purpose | Generate schema markup to enhance content visibility and potentially earn rich snippets in search results. |
---|---|
Key Features | Supports local business, FAQ, and product schema; integrates with Google’s Rich Results Test for validation. |
Use Case | Suitable for SEO professionals and developers aiming to improve SERP visibility with structured data. |
This tool simplifies the process of adding schema markup, boosting content discoverability.
